Xenia Hotels & Resorts, Inc. announced that its board of directors elected Marcel Verbaas to the role of Chairman of the Board. Mr. Verbaas will also continue to serve as the company's Chief Executive Officer. In addition, the Board has appointed Barry A.N. Bloom to the position of President and Chief Operating Officer. The current Chairman of the Board, Jeffrey H. Donahue, will now serve as Lead Director of the Board. Mr. Verbaas has served as President and Chief Executive Officer of the company since its formation in 2007 and guided the company through its spin-off from its prior parent company and its listing on the New York Stock Exchange in February 2015. Since listing, Mr. Verbaas has successfully overseen the execution of the company's strategic plan to position the company for long-term value creation by refining and upgrading the portfolio through capital improvements and over $1.6 billion of acquisitions and dispositions. Mr. Bloom joined Xenia in July 2013 and has served as Executive Vice President and Chief Operating Officer since joining the company.
Xenia Hotels & Resorts, Inc. is a self-advised and self-administered real estate investment trust (REIT) that invests in luxury and upper upscale hotels and resorts with a focus on the top 25 lodging markets as well as leisure destinations in the United States. The Company owns approximately 32 hotels and resorts comprising 9,514 rooms across 14 states. The Company's hotels are in the luxury and upper upscale segments, and are operated and/or licensed by Marriott, Hyatt, Kimpton, Fairmont, Loews, Hilton, The Kessler Collection, and Davidson. Its hotels include Andaz Napa; Andaz San Diego; Andaz Savannah; Bohemian Hotel Savannah Riverfront, Autograph Collection; Fairmont Dallas; Fairmont Pittsburgh; Grand Bohemian Hotel Charleston, Autograph Collection; Grand Bohemian Hotel Mountain Brook, Autograph Collection; Grand Bohemian Hotel Orlando, Autograph Collection; Hyatt Centric Key West Resort & Spa; Hyatt Regency Grand Cypress, and Hyatt Regency Portland at the Oregon Convention Center.
